    ACAD Model Space / Paper Space Not updating changes from one to other

    Take my word for it . . . this is an Annotative Scaling issue. Annotative Scaling affects many objects other than text, and if you have not set up one of your "spaces" for Annotative Scaling, then the objects from the other "space" will not show up on it.     PDF plot

    Regarding the PDF quality . . . I found that while you are in the PLOT screen, and you increase the quality to maximum, then your PDF will be nice and sharp as you zoom closer and closer. I have the best luck with PDF995 software. -Rocky Cheers . . .
